The IMEI number is unique and used by a GSM network to identify valid devices and therefore can be used for stopping a stolen phone from accessing that network.
For example, if a mobile phone is stolen, the owner can call their network provider and instruct them to blacklist the phone using its IMEI number.
The Check Digit is a function of all other digits in the IMEI. The purpose of the Check Digit is to help guard against the possibility of incorrect entries to the CEIR and EIR equipment. There are a few ways to find your device details. These details typical include:
● IMEI
● Serial Number
● Model Number
Please see below as there are alternate methods on how to locate theyourdevice details.
Please Note: Screenshots below were taken from Android OS Version 9.0 (Pie).
1Swipe down on your screen to access your Quick Settings and tap on the Settings cogwheel
2Scroll down to the bottom and tap on About phone
3The Model Number, Serial Number and IMEI will be displayed
Steps via the Phone app (IMEI and Serial Number only)Click to Expand
1On the Home Screen, tap on the Phone app.
2Head to your Keypad and dial *#06#
3The screen displayed will show you the IMEI number of your current device as well as the Serial Number (S/N).

All Samsung products will have the Model Number and Serial number on the device itself somewhere, usually it's on the back closer to the bottom. Sometimes it's hard to read because of the colour of the product, and the text can be small on phones, tablets and wearables. If it's too hard to read on the product itself - check the box the device came in, as the Serial Number will be there too. In India, if you buy a phone or tablet that takes a SIM, it is required by law to put the IMEI on the sale receipt.

If you have lost your device, you can also try the ‘Find My Mobile’ service. You can remotely locate your lost smartphone, back up data stored on the device to Samsung Cloud, lock the screen, and even block access to Samsung Pay. You can also delete all data stored on your device.
Note: To use the ‘Find My Mobile’ service, 1) You must have set up your Samsung account on your device. 2) You allow Google to collect your location information and agree to the 'Use wireless networks' term and conditions.
